Edward Capriolo commented on HIVE-454: -------------------------------------- Digging into this some more it seems that the query processor and cli driver would have to work together in a different way. As of now the CLIDriver is physically splitting on ';' it can not tell the difference between ';' and '/;'. My patch adds some logic to detect '/;' and unescape it before passing to qp.run(String). Right now we can argue that the CliDriver has an implicit 'autocommit=true'. We can make this an explicit variable. with autocommit='false' the query processor would hold a StringBuffer or a queue of query strings. 'commit ' ; would cause QP to run each query in its queue. This is a non-trivial change. If we add this feature we can set autocommit=true so the default behavior does not change.
